Buttermilk Waffles Ingredients

  • All-purpose flour (2 cups): Gives structure so waffles hold their shape yet stay tender.
  • Sugar (2 tablespoons): Lightly sweetens and helps the surface caramelize and crisp.
  • Baking powder (2 teaspoons): Provides lift for airy pockets.
  • Baking soda (1 teaspoon): Reacts with buttermilk for extra rise and a golden finish.
  • Salt (½ teaspoon): Balances sweetness and sharpens flavor.
  • Buttermilk (2 cups, warm): Adds tang, tenderness, and steam for a soft interior. Learn How to Make Buttermilk using 2 cups of milk and lemon juice.
  • Butter (⅓ cup, melted): Enriches the batter and promotes crisp edges.
  • Eggs (2): Bind the batter and create a light, custardy crumb.
  • Vanilla extract (1 teaspoon): Adds bakery style aroma and rounds out the flavor.

How to Make Buttermilk Waffles

BATTER. In a medium bowl, whisk 2 cups flour, 2 tablespoons sugar, 2 teaspoons baking powder, 1 teaspoon baking soda, and ½ teaspoon salt. 

In another medium bowl, whisk 2 cups buttermilk and ⅓ cup melted butter. Add 2 eggs and stir until combined.

Add the flour mixture to wet ingredients and whisk until just combined (there were still lumps). Fold in 1 teaspoon vanilla. Let the batter rest for 10 minutes.

COOK. Preheat the waffle iron and grease. Pour about ⅓-½ cup of batter into the waffle iron (or until the batter reaches about ½ inch to the edge of the iron). Cook until ready. Top with syrup and berries. 

Kristyn’s Recipe Tips

  • Do not over-mix, whisk just until combined and leave small lumps so the crumb stays tender.
  • Rest the batter 10 minutes as written, this hydrates flour and boosts browning.
  • Preheat the waffle iron fully and grease lightly, hot plates give the best crisp edges.
  • Keep finished waffles warm and crisp on a rack set over a sheet pan in a 225°F oven until serving.

Notes

Favorite toppings. Maple Syrup, Cinnamon Buttermilk Syrup, Whipped Cream, powdered sugar, and fresh berries, 
Prep ahead. The batter can be made the night before and kept covered in the fridge. Allow it to come to room temperature and give it a gentle stir before pouring it into the waffle iron.
Store leftover waffles in an airtight container in the fridge for 3-4 days or wrap each waffle in plastic and store them together in a container in the freezer for 2-3 months.
